Specialized in environmentally sustainable commercial and residential interiors, designer Jessica Helgerson took the challenge of remodeling a once run-down split-level ranch house, into a mid-century modern residence. And I’m telling you it wasn’t easy. They had to “chop down” the existing master bathroom and the kitchen in order to create a bright and airy living room that now opens to a lovely garden. But that’s not all. Every piece of furniture and other vintage finds has been reupholstered and refinished, to follow the new modernish theme of the house.
